“…Both Unified Power Flow Controller (UPFC) and Thyristor Controlled Series Capacitor (TCSC) have been widely used to dampen low-frequency oscillations. Adding an auxiliary controller to FACTS will considerably increase the power system damping [5]. However, the damping of oscillations in a power system is greatly affected by the parameters of the FACTS-based stabilizers and their locations within the network.…”
